do you own another sampler ?
I tend to use my sp202 to process samples but I record them from the 202 to other samplers that have more memory like my sp404 or MPC, also I record them back to my mac...
since the 90's I've rarely used the 202 to play back samples for production.. I do have a few memory cards though

I've never seen a modded SP-202 but don't think anything could be done other than turning it into a glitch box, if that's your thing. As far as modding the memory input, it's not possible since it's part of the motherboard.
